To provide a vehicular control unit which can avoid my room mode from stopping.SOLUTION: A vehicular electronic control unit (ECU) 50 for a vehicle 10 comprises: a low temperature-side cooling water circuit 20 which cools a boosting converter 12 and a battery 11 and is cooled by a chiller 24 and a low temperature-side radiator 25; a refrigeration cycle circuit 30 which adsorbs, by the chiller 24, heat from the low temperature-side cooling water circuit 20; and a high temperature-side cooling water circuit 40 which is cooled by a high temperature-side radiator 44. Therein: the low temperature-side radiator 25 is disposed in the vicinity of the high temperature-side radiator 44; my room mode can be set which drives an auxiliary machinery during charging the battery 11 by a power supply facility; and a number of revolution of a compressor 31 is reduced according to temperature of low temperature-side cooling water if the temperature in the low temperature-side cooling water is prescribed temperature or more when the my room mode is set.SELECTED DRAWING: Figure 1
